Greetings I am very new to GPS and have recently purchased a Globalsat bc 307 CF for my Toshiba e800 Pocket pc. the problem I am having is that when I insert the CF receiver it defaults to "COM:4 CF_CARD-GENERIC: and it receives all incoming data (sat) but when I try to run it with MS Streets and Trips it says " the communications (COM) port is available, but no signal is being received. Make sure the GPS receiver is turned on and connected to the correct port" when I try to configure it on the PPC it only offers COM3: or COM9: I have now downloaded Mapopolis and it says waiting for signal I am slowly pulling out my hair and need help can anyone assist me....

Have you succesfully had a signal showing on the GPSinfo program that comes with the receiver? I am not familiar with your PPC but it sounds as though your receiver will use the generic driver through COM 4 and you should see it on GPSinfo. You may have to wait a while for this if the unit is new.

If you have used GPSinfo, then in order for the receiver to work with other software, you must make sure that you hit the 'Close GPS' button in GPSinfo, otherwise it will not let anything else connect.

Hopefully, another Tosh user will come along and help you further but I have seen other entries for this machine in these forums where owners have had difficulties (recently). A search may help.
